Practical Points for Choosing the Right Page Count and Format

The page count you select changes the journal’s personality. At 100 pages, the book feels light and approachable; it’s often the go-to for a 12-month journal with just enough room for monthly prompts and a brief recap. Bump up to 120 or 150 pages, and suddenly you have capacity for weekly check-ins, quarterly reviews, and a few blank reflection pages at the end. The best practice I recommend to new publishers is to download the Monthly Reflection KDP Interior PDF from the source, print a few pages at home, and actually write in them. Feel the line spacing. See how much a month’s worth of thoughts fills one side. That physical test will tell you more about the ideal page count than any market report.

No-bleed design also simplifies cover creation. You don’t need to extend elements into a bleed margin, so your cover designer—or your own Canva skills—can focus purely on composition. The 8.5″ x 11″ trim is so standard that KDP’s cover template calculator handles the spine width automatically. This speeds up the publishing workflow dramatically.

When Commercial Fonts and Embedded Files Remove Roadblocks

One sticky point in low-content publishing is font licensing. Many free fonts aren’t licensed for embedding in a commercial PDF for resale, and the last thing a creator wants is a legal tangle over a journal heading. With this Monthly Reflection KDP Interior, the typeface is already a vetted commercial font, fully embedded and print-ready. You’re not responsible for tracking down a separate desktop license or converting text to outlines. The PDF retains crisp, searchable text where needed, though the majority of each page remains the beautifully ruled blank space that buyers prize.

Another thoughtful detail: the interior’s resolution sits at a genuine 300 DPI, meaning the lines and any soft guide elements print without stair-stepping. I’ve reviewed interiors submitted at 150 DPI that looked passable on screen but fuzzy in print. That’s not the case here. The line quality holds up even under the scrutiny of a proof copy held at arm’s length. For a reflection journal—where the tactile, pen-to-paper experience is the whole point—that sharpness translates into confidence for the end user.
